Sqlalchemy是一个Python的ORM(对象关系映射)库,用于简化与数据库的交互。其中的largebinary是Sqlalchemy提供的一种数据类型,用于存储二进制数据。
在迁移数据后没有编码的情况下,可能会导致数据无法正确解析或显示。为了解决这个问题,可以考虑以下几个方面:
from sqlalchemy import create_engine
engine = create_engine('mysql://user:password@host/database?charset=utf8')
上述代码中,charset=utf8指定了连接的编码方式为UTF-8。
综上所述,对于Sqlalchemy的largebinary数据类型在迁移数据后没有编码的情况,可以通过检查数据库编码设置、连接编码设置、表字段编码设置,并进行数据编码转换来解决。
领取专属 10元无门槛券
手把手带您无忧上云